The Laubenheimer-Bodenheimer Ried is an FFH and nature reserve. Its floodplain landscape with small lakes and ponds is an indispensable habitat for numerous animal and plant species.
The Laubenheimer-Bodenheimer Ried is a significant nature reserve in Rhineland-Palatinate, holding the highest EU protection status as an FFH area. This unique floodplain landscape near the Rhine is characterized by its diverse small lakes and ponds, which serve as indispensable habitats. The protected area preserves the region's unique biodiversity. It is of outstanding value for the many animal and plant species native here. The intact waters and surrounding wetlands form a complex ecosystem crucial for the conservation of rare and endangered species, contributing significantly to natural diversity.
| Location | Germany - Rheinland-Pfalz - Mainz-Bingen, Mainz, Kreisfreie Stadt |
| Area | 72.02ha |
| Year of foundation | 1982 |
| IUCN Category | IV |
